Descript

Descript emerges as a robust alternative to Captions.ai. Unlike Captions.ai, Descript doesn’t have a mobile app but offers a dedicated desktop application alongside a web-based version.

Descript excels in text-based editing. It automatically transcribes your audio into editable text and allows precise editing by deleting specific sections of the video.

Descript dashboard: captions ai mobile app alternative

Descript offers a unique feature where you can type your text to add voiceovers. It even allows for voice cloning, enabling video editing directly through text manipulation.

Moreover, Descript boasts a range of advanced features including speech enhancement, AI eye contact, customizable subtitle templates, the ability to extract viral clips from longer videos, an AI background remover, and much more.

Descript’s AI text-to-speech functionality delivers remarkably realistic voiceovers. Overall, Descript covers all the essential features found in the Captions app.

Additionally, Descript supports screen recording and remote recording, making it possible to conduct studio-quality online meetings without the constraints of internet connectivity.

Veed

Veed is a cloud-based video editor that has recently integrated AI features into its platform. Subtitling and transcription are just some of the features offered by Veed.

Recently, Veed also introduced a mobile app tailored for iPhone users, focusing on adding video captions seamlessly.

 class= lazyload

Veed offers a wide range of subtitle templates along with extensive customization options, making it a superior choice for users prioritizing subtitles. Beyond that, Veed boasts a comprehensive suite of video editing features compared to Captions AI and Descript.

Among its notable AI capabilities are speech enhancement, voice cloning, AI background remover, and AI avatars. Additionally, Veed allows users to dub videos into different languages.

Unlike Descript, Veed does not support text-based editing.

Capcut

CapCut is a robust alternative to TikTok itself, available across multiple platforms and designed specifically for short-form content creators.

CapCut is free to use, allowing users to export unlimited videos. However, its subtitle templates are basic, and its transcription accuracy falls short compared to Captions AI and other alternatives.

Capcut Captions Ai alternative

CapCut lacks an AI eye contact feature but excels in many other areas, making it a top choice for short-form content creators.

For instance, it includes Auto Reframe, also known as AI or Smart Crop, along with text-based editing capabilities. CapCut features a Text-to-Speech (TTS) function with various voices and a voice cloning feature.

Additionally, CapCut offers unlimited AI avatar video generation for free, positioning it as a robust alternative to Heygen.

CapCut boasts a vast library of pre-made effects, filters, and user-friendly templates.

Opus Pro

Opus Pro is a powerful tool designed to transform long-form videos into viral short clips effortlessly. It automatically identifies the most engaging segments and intelligently crops them to fit formats like reels and TikTok dimensions.

Moreover, the tool seamlessly adds captions to your videos and provides a virality score to estimate potential reach. It also features AI-generated B-roll footage, enhancing the visual appeal of your edits.

For further customization, Opus Pro allows you to export edited videos in XML format, compatible with Premiere Pro.
